Physical Possession
The actual holding or control of property, as opposed to constructive possession which is the legal right to control.
Insurable Interest
The legitimate interest or stake a policyholder must have in the subject matter of the insurance policy, such that they would suffer financial loss or damage from its harm or destruction.
Goods In Bailment
Items that are temporarily transferred into another's custody for a specific purpose, but ownership is not transferred.
Risk Of Loss
The potential for an asset to be lost, damaged, or destroyed, impacting its owner's financial position.
